Abstract :
This paper discusses the importance of innovation and adding value to products and services in order for the high-growth small and medium enterprises (SME) in Europe to remain competitive in an increasingly globalized marketplace. The issue of lack of resources among SMEs can be addressed by allowing them to be part of an innovative consortia where they can not only share R&D costs but also knowledge. This can also provide indirect opportunities for marketing through consortia partners and diffuses the envy, failure and blame culture that pervades European society. The chances of success depends heavily on having the best possible partner-search process and professional assistance in consortium building, which could be pan-European or global coupled with adequate funding opportunities made available by the EC for the majority of high-growth SMEs.
